  • 7. What are Phytosterols?
    • Phytosterols , also known as plant sterols , are a naturally occurring class of compounds found in the cells and membranes of plants. These plant lipid-like compounds are present at low levels in grains, fruits and vegetables . There are approximately 250 different sterols and related compounds in plant and marine materials with the most common ones beta-sitosterol, stigmasterol, and campesterol. Used to inhibit the production of enzymes 5 alpha reductase/aromatase

  • 21. HISTOLOGY NORMAL ASPECT Network of Pre-Collagen Reticular Fibrils Blood Vessel Adipocytes Interstice between Adipocytes Under normal conditions, the adipose tissue is well sprinkled: the capillary vessels are very close to the adipocytes cytoplasmatic membrane. REGENESIS BioComplex ANTICELLULITE CREME GEL
  • 22. HISTOLOGY PATHOLOGICAL ASPECT-1st and 2nd stage The first consequence of the venular stasis is the abnormal endhothelial permeability followed by the transudation of plasma into the interstitial tissue. Ectasia- microaneurisms of blood transudate Dissociation of Adipocytes Edematous Transudate Flooding of Interstices REGENESIS BioComplex ANTICELLULITE CREME GEL
  • 23. HISTOLOGY PATHOLOGICAL ASPECT -3rd stage PATHOLOGICAL ASPECT -4th stage Representation of a micronodule: a considerable number of altered adipocytes is surrounded by a full-fledged capsule of collagenous fibrils and consequently isolated from the tissue. The merging of several micronodules, having microscopic dimension, give rise to so-called macronodule, that can be detected through digital palpation. Capsule of thick-scleroialinotic connetive fibrils Adipocytes altered by abiotrophic regressive processes Macronodules capsule Micronodules forming macronodule
